How to set frequency and channel

Setting frequency and channel is actually very simple. Most walkie-talkies have a knob or button through which you can select different frequencies and channels. For example, you turn the knob to “frequency 1”, and then select “channel 1”, so it is set. If you need to talk to someone else, just make sure your frequency and channel settings are the same.

Some common frequencies and channels

Public channels: These channels are open and can be used by anyone. For example, some outdoor walkie-talkies have public channels that are suitable for use in parks, shopping malls, and other places.

Dedicated channels: These channels are dedicated to some specific people or organizations, including police officers, firefighters. use special channels that are not available to ordinary people.
